In a moment that perfectly encapsulated the essence of teamwork, Will Campbell, a rookie offensive lineman for the New England Patriots, demonstrated exactly what it means to put the team first — even at the risk of personal confrontation. During a joint practice between the Patriots and Washington Commanders, tensions escalated, leading to a full-blown scuffle. In the middle of the chaos, Campbell didn’t hesitate. He rushed in without a second thought to defend his teammates, making it clear that his loyalty to the Patriots is unmatched.
